FET Shield for FRDM-KL25Z

by icenyne.

2 layer board of 1.89x2.06 inches (48.03x52.20 mm).
Shared on December 28th, 2013 19:27.

This shield for the FRDM-KL25Z allows controlling 18 SOT-23 FETs to pull down external non-inductive loads. It was originally designed to drive two large 7-segment displays and a DSLR for a photo booth application. The control function has since been moved to an i.MX6Q Sabre SD board…

microKL25Z-v1

by icenyne.

2 layer board of 0.65x1.35 inches (16.54x34.29 mm).
Shared on October 17th, 2013 19:36.

DIP breakout board for KL25Z. Board is tested and it works.

Soldering the QFN is a little bit of a pain: use gentle hot air or a hot plate. Pre-tin the pad ring first. Solder the tab after the pad ring is soldered.
